How to Choose the Right Tie Dye Kurta Set

Haldi ceremonies are usually held outdoors, so yellow and saffron shades look the most radiant. Viscose and rayon are lightweight and comfortable, while cotton-silk adds a subtle shine. Styling Tips for Haldi

Pair your tie dye kurta with oxidized silver jewelry or floral accessories for a lively look. Organza or chiffon dupattas balance the dyed fabric texture. Embroidered juttis or block heels keep the outfit festive yet practical. A small potli bag in a contrasting shade completes the ensemble.

What fabric is best for a tie dye kurta set for haldi ceremony?

Viscose and rayon are ideal fabrics for a haldi ceremony. They feel light, resist turmeric stains, and stay cool in warm weather. Cotton-silk blends add a refined touch if you want a slightly dressier look without losing comfort.

How do I care for a tie dye kurta set after the haldi ceremony?

Hand wash your kurta separately in cold water using mild detergent. Avoid bleach and long soaking. Dry it in shade to maintain the dye pattern and use gentle steam to keep the garment crisp and fresh.

What colors are ideal for a haldi ceremony outfit?

Yellow, saffron, and marigold are the most popular colors for Haldi. These hues match the turmeric used in rituals and look lively in photos. You can also try pale orange or ivory accents for a softer tone.
